How many types of bioreactor are there?

The six types are: (1) Continuous Stirred Tank Bioreactors (2) Bubble Column Bioreactors (3) Airlift Bioreactors (4) Fluidized Bed Bioreactors (5) Packed Bed Bioreactors and (6) Photo-Bioreactors.

What are the components of bioreactor?

These components include a jacketed stainless steel vessel, temperature control, agitation, sparge gas control, head sweep gas control, pH and dissolved oxygen control.

What is the use of bioreactors?

What is a bioreactor. An apparatus for growing organisms (yeast, bacteria, or animal cells) under controlled conditions. Used in industrial processes to produce pharmaceuticals, vaccines, or antibodies. Also used to convert raw materials into useful byproducts such as in the bioconversion of corn into ethanol.

What are bioreactors used for?

Bioreactor systems are a vital component in the process of 3D tissue engineering and the formation of tissue constructs. Bioreactors are used to provide a tissue-specific physiological in vitro environment during tissue maturation. Based on the bioreactor technology, various tissue systems can be incubated in vitro.

What are the 4 steps of fermentation?

The fermentation process consists of four stages. The four stages are: (1) Inoculum Preservation (2) Inoculum Build-up (3) Pre-Fermenter Culture and (4) Production Fermentation.
